欢迎访问琢舟百科

前端优化网站性能的关键策略与技巧

频道:关键词优化步骤 日期: 浏览:11523
摘要:本文将介绍前端优化网站性能的关键策略与技巧。为了提高网站的响应速度、用户体验和搜索引擎优化,我们需要关注前端性能优化。本文将探讨减少页面加载时间、优化图片加载、利用缓存技术、压缩代码和资源文件、使用高效的布局和渲染技术等方面的技巧。通过实施这些策略,我们可以提高网站的性能,提供更好的用户体验,并提升搜索引擎排名。

随着互联网技术的飞速发展,网站性能优化已成为前端工程师必须掌握的核心技能之一,一个高性能的网站不仅能提升用户体验,还能提高搜索引擎排名,从而带来更多的流量和收益,本文将详细介绍前端如何优化网站性能,帮助开发者提升网站的整体性能。

减少页面加载时间

页面加载时间是衡量网站性能的重要指标之一,优化页面加载时间可以从以下几个方面入手:

1、压缩资源文件:通过压缩CSS、JS文件,减少文件体积,从而减少传输时间,可以使用Gzip压缩算法进行文件压缩。

2、缓存静态资源:利用浏览器缓存机制,缓存CSS、JS、图片等静态资源,避免重复下载。

前端优化网站性能的关键策略与技巧

3、懒加载技术:对于页面中的图片、视频等资源,采用懒加载技术,延迟加载非视口内容,提高首屏加载速度。

4、优化代码:精简JavaScript和CSS代码,移除无效代码和冗余代码,提高代码执行效率。

优化图片和多媒体资源

图片和多媒体资源是网站中占用带宽较大的部分,优化这些资源可以有效提升网站性能。

1、使用合适的图片格式:根据图片类型和用途选择合适的图片格式,如JPEG、PNG、WebP等。

2、优化图片大小:压缩图片,减少图片体积,同时保证图片质量。

3、使用媒体查询:根据用户设备屏幕大小和内容重要性,使用媒体查询技术来加载合适的图片尺寸和分辨率。

前端优化网站性能的关键策略与技巧

4、视频优化:采用视频懒加载和自适应码率技术,提高视频加载速度和播放质量。

利用浏览器缓存

浏览器缓存可以有效减少网络请求,提高网站性能,前端开发者可以通过以下几个方面利用浏览器缓存机制:

1、设置合适的缓存策略:根据资源更新频率和重要性,设置合适的缓存时间,对于不经常更新的静态资源可以设置较长的缓存时间。

2、使用ETag和Last-Modified头信息:通过ETag和Last-Modified头信息,告诉浏览器资源是否发生变化,从而避免不必要的网络请求。

3、避免缓存击穿:合理设计缓存键,避免缓存击穿问题。

优化JavaScript执行效率

JavaScript是前端性能优化的重点之一,优化JavaScript执行效率可以从以下几个方面入手:

前端优化网站性能的关键策略与技巧

1、异步加载和执行:使用异步加载和执行技术(如async/await、Web Workers),避免阻塞页面渲染。

2、减少DOM操作:尽量减少DOM操作次数,通过批量操作、虚拟DOM等技术提高DOM操作效率。

3、代码拆分和懒加载:将JavaScript代码进行拆分,按需加载和执行,减少首屏加载时间。

利用前端框架和工具

前端框架和工具可以帮助开发者更高效地开发网站,提高网站性能。

1、使用前端框架:使用成熟的前端框架(如React、Vue等),利用框架提供的优化策略和工具,提高网站性能。

2、使用性能监控工具:利用性能监控工具(如PageSpeed Insights、Lighthouse等),监控网站性能,发现瓶颈并进行优化。

前端优化网站性能的关键策略与技巧

3、CDN部署:通过CDN(内容分发网络)部署静态资源,提高用户访问速度和网站性能。

前端优化网站性能是一个持续的过程,需要开发者不断学习和实践,通过减少页面加载时间、优化图片和多媒体资源、利用浏览器缓存、优化JavaScript执行效率以及利用前端框架和工具等手段,可以有效提升网站性能,提高用户体验和搜索引擎排名,在实际开发中,开发者应根据网站实际情况和需求,选择合适的优化策略和技巧。


与本文知识相关的文章:

重庆网站优化免费咨询公司(专业SEO优化团队为您解惑)

谷歌网站优化公司蚌埠(找到最适合的网站优化服务商)

乌鲁木齐网站优化来电咨询 乌鲁木齐热线服务电话

重庆怎么优化网站排名靠前(SEO排名优化攻略)

网站建设优化公司如何选择(选择优质网站建设优化公司的方法)